.TH XtAddExposureToRegion 3Xt "Release 3" "X Version 11" "XT FUNCTIONS"
.SH NAME
XtAddExposureToRegion \- merge exposure events into a region
.SH SYNTAX
void XtAddExposureToRegion(\fIevent\fP, \fIregion\fP)
.br
XEvent *\fIevent\fP;
.br
Region \fIregion\fP;
.SH ARGUMENTS
.IP \fIevent\fP 1i
Specifies a pointer to the
.ZN Expose
or
.ZN GraphicsExpose
event.
.IP \fIregion\fP 1i
Specifies the region object (as defined in
.Pn < X11/Xutil.h >).
.SH DESCRIPTION
The
.ZN XtAddExposureToRegion
function computes the union of the rectangle defined by the exposure
event and the specified region.
Then, it stores the results back in region.
If the event argument is not an
.ZN Expose
or
.ZN GraphicsExpose
event,
.ZN XtAddExposureToRegion
returns without an error and without modifying region.
.LP
This function is used by the exposure compression mechanism
(see Section 7.9.3).
